Hey guys,
Just an update on this - using a 3.0 nightly for 3ds Max now you can replace in the output path of a Phoenix simulator the "aur" extension with "vdb" and it would export VDB caches. Note that this way you need to set an explicit path and can't use the $(...) macros. For now this is just an experimental feature and we will add a better interface for it with time. Please do tell if you find any issues with it.
